Q: What is the Best Lighting for growing plants indoors?

A: Metal halide lights are a good lighting choice for growing your plants indoors when there is no sunlight available. Metal halide lighting emits more light rays in the blue spectrum. Blue light regulates the rate of a plants growth as well as other plant responses including stomata opening.

Q: What is the best light for plant growth?

A: High intensity metal halide lights are best for plants that need high light conditions during the leafy vegetative growth stages. High intensity lights are more expensive than fluorescent lights and not cost effective for most small home gardens.

Q: What is a plant light?

A: A grow or plant light is an electrical light that provides an artificial source of light to stimulate the growth of plants. Grow lights achieve this function by emitting electromagnetic radiation in the visible light spectrum that simulates sunlight for the important process of photosynthesis.
